XML 40 R30.htm IDEA: XBRL DOCUMENT v3.21.2
NOTE 2 - SUMMARY OF SIGNIFICANT ACCOUNTING POLICIES: REVENUE RECOGNITION (Policies)
3 Months Ended
Jul. 31, 2021
Policies  
REVENUE RECOGNITION

REVENUE RECOGNITION

 

Pursuant to the guidance of ASC 606, we record revenue when persuasive evidence of an arrangement exists, product delivery has occurred, the sales price to the customer is fixed or determinable, and collectability is reasonably assured. The adoption of this guidance did not have a material impact on our unaudited condensed consolidated financial statements. 

 

In accordance with ASC 606, we recognize revenues from the sale of stevia and other productions upon shipment and transfer of title based on the trade terms. All product sales with customer specific acceptance provisions are recognized upon customer acceptance and the delivery of the products. We report revenues net of applicable sales taxes and related surcharges. The Company determines revenue recognition through the following steps:

 

 

Identify the contract with a customer;

 

 

Identify the performance obligations in the contract;

 

 

Determine the transaction price;

 

 

Allocate the transaction price to the performance obligations in the contract; and

 

 

Recognize revenue when (or as) the entity satisfies a performance obligation.

 

 

The Company is also a lessor, which is an entity that is lease underlying asset to the third party, The Company’s lease revenue is recognized under ASC Topic 842, Leases, (“ASC 842”), which was adopted on May 1, 2019. In general, the Company commences rental revenue recognition when the tenant takes possession of the leased space and the leased space is substantially ready for its intended use. The Company’s lease has been accounted for as operating lease. Rental revenue is recognized on a straight-line basis over the terms of the lease of five years. Actual amounts billed in accordance with the lease during any given period may have been higher or lower than the amount of rental revenue recognized for the period. The difference by which straight-line rental revenue exceeded rents billed in accordance with lease agreements is recorded as “accounts receivable”. The difference by which rents billed in accordance with lease agreements exceeded straight-line rental revenue is recorded as “advances from customer”. The Company does not offset lease income and lease expense.